It's very hot there. The city has some wonderful places to visit and is central to many more in that area of the province. Lots of shopping and eating out options as well as parks. It's not a large city so easy to get around with the main highway running through it. So many trails in beautiful river settings too!

We were there as my husband was having surgery at the hospital. Hospital was fantastic. Great staff, not super busy. Enjoyed being close to a lovely shopping centre. The downtown of Medicine Hat was very interesting . Lots of historic buildings. Beautiful little parks and flowers. Found one cafe called “Inspire” that was also an art gallery showcasing local artists. Great lunch and coffee place.
